Latest Patents

Pohlmann's latest patents include an innovative exhaust gas catalyst. This catalyst consists of approximately 50 to 95% by weight of silicon carbide and 5 to 50% by weight of an alloy of silicon with various metals, including copper, iron, and platinum. The catalyst's surface can be activated through oxidation or chemical treatment, enhancing its effectiveness. Another significant patent is for an apparatus designed for firing ceramic shaped products, particularly porcelain tableware. This apparatus features a kiln with a through tunnel, grid-like pallets, and a heating device, which ensures a more uniform firing atmosphere and simplifies the production of product holder plates.
